1. Understanding the Value of CBDV in the Market

CBDV (Cannabidivarin) is gaining traction due to its potential in treating neurological conditions, especially epilepsy and autism spectrum disorders. Unlike CBD or THC, CBDV interacts uniquely with the body’s endocannabinoid system, making it a high-value cannabinoid for pharmaceutical and therapeutic research. As a result, demand is growing — but supply remains limited due to the complexity of extraction and production. This makes finding a reputable manufacturer more critical than ever.

2. Certifications and Compliance Are Non-Negotiable

The global cannabinoid market is heavily regulated. Buyers should ensure that any CBDV manufacturer they consider is GMP (Good Manufacturing Practice) certified and compliant with local and international standards, including ISO certification and third-party lab testing.

3. Track Record and Supply Chain Transparency

A reliable CBDV manufacturer will offer a transparent supply chain, from hemp cultivation to final extraction. They should be able to provide Certificates of Analysis (COAs) for each batch and proof of origin for all raw materials. 5. Global Logistics and Export Readiness

Export readiness is a vital concern for global buyers. The manufacturer must be experienced in international logistics, with appropriate documentation for customs, import laws, and regulatory paperwork.

Particularly when sourcing from European CBN suppliers, import/export paperwork must include product labelling, cannabinoid concentration details, and legality in the buyer’s country. CBDV falls into similar grey areas in many jurisdictions, so having a manufacturer who can navigate these complexities is essential.
